본문 바로가기

프로그래밍 기술 노트/Linux | WSL

리눅스 SSH 접속 closed 되는 현상

리눅스 에서 ssh 가 안될때

 

1. 로그 확인

:라즈베리파이 우분투 마테 기준 /var/log/auth.log 확인.

 

2. Could not load host key: /etc/ssh/ssh_host_rsa_key ... 과 같이 key가 없는 경우 나오는 에러

: ssh-keygen -f /etc/ssh/ssh_host_rsa_key -t rsa -N "" 처럼 없는 key를 생성해준다.

 

2-1: sudo ssh-keygen -A하면 자동 생성

 

2-2 : 수동생성

ex) rsa,ecdsa,ed25519 키가 없으면 다음 명령어.

sudo ssh-keygen -f /etc/ssh/ssh_host_rsa_key -t rsa -N ""

sudo ssh-keygen -f /etc/ssh/ssh_host_ecdsa_key -t ecdsa -N ""

sudo ssh-keygen -f /etc/ssh/ssh_host_ed25519_key -t ed25519 -N ""

728x90